Katalyst Space LINK Spacecraft Experiences Critical Failure in Orbit

A crucial mission to boost the orbit of NASA’s Swift observatory is facing significant challenges after the Katalyst Space LINK spacecraft, tasked with the orbital adjustment, began tumbling uncontrollably. The incident occurred shortly after the spacecraft reached orbit, complicating efforts to save the vital orbital telescope.

System Malfunctions and Operational Impact

The loss of control is attributed to key component failures within LINK’s attitude control system. These malfunctions have resulted in intermittent communication with ground control and triggered an onboard computer reboot. Currently, the LINK spacecraft is in an uncontrolled spin, severely hindering its ability to perform its intended mission. Despite the critical setback, teams are actively working to regain control and maintain hope for the successful completion of the Swift observatory rescue mission.
